Centos 설정 nginx 시작 및 서비스 설정

쓸데없는 말.
1. 시스템 에서 파일 만 들 기
cd /lib/systemd/system/
vim nginx.service

2、
[Unit]
Description=nginx service
After=network.target 
   
[Service] 
Type=forking 
ExecStart=/usr/local/nginx/sbin/nginx
ExecReload=/usr/local/nginx/sbin/nginx -s reload
ExecStop=/usr/local/nginx/sbin/nginx -s quit
PrivateTmp=true 
   
[Install] 
WantedBy=multi-user.target

3. 저장, 다음은 매개 변수 설명
[Unit]:     
Description:    
After:      
[Service]         
Type=forking        
ExecStart          
ExecReload     
ExecStop     
PrivateTmp=True              
  :[Service]   、  、              
[Install]              ,       ,        3

4, 가입 켜 기 자동 시작
systemctl enable nginx

5, 자동 시작 취소
systemctl disable nginx

6. 명령:
# systemctl start nginx.service            nginx  
# systemctl stop nginx.service               
# systemctl restart nginx.service              
# systemctl list-units --type=service               
# systemctl status nginx.service                  
# systemctl enable nginx.service                 
# systemctl disable nginx.service                

좋은 웹페이지 즐겨찾기